SECTION 2 COMPOSITION / INFORMATION ON INGREDIENTS
・ Substance or preparation: Preparation
・ Information about the chemical nature of product: *1
Portion
Material name
Concentration range (wt %)
Positive electrode
Lithium transition metal oxidate (Li[M]
m
[O]
n
*2)
20~60
Positive electrode’s base
Aluminum
1~10
Negative electrode
Carbon
10~30
Negative electrode’s base
Copper
1~15
Electrolyte
Organic electrolyte principally involves ester carbonate
5~25
Outer case
Aluminum, iron, aluminum laminated plastic
1~30
*1 Not every product includes all of these materials.
*2 The letter M means transition metal and candidates of M are Co, Mn, Ni and Al. One compound includes one or more of these metals
and one product includes one or more of the compounds. The letter m and n means the number of atoms.
SECTION 3 HAZARDS IDENTIFICATION
For the battery cell, chemical materials are stored in a hermetically sealed metal or metal laminated plastic case, designed to withstand
temperatures and pressures encountered during normal use. As a result, during normal use, there is no physical danger of ignition or
explosion and chemical danger of hazardous materials' leakage.
However, if exposed to a fire, added mechanical shocks, decomposed, added electric stress by miss-use, the gas release vent will be
operated. The battery cell case will be breached at the extreme, hazardous materials may be released.
Moreover, if heated strongly by the surrounding fire, acrid gas may be emitted.
・ Most important hazard and effects
Human health effects:
Inhalation:
The steam of the electrolyte has an anesthesia action and stimulates a respiratory tract.
Skin contact: The steam of the electrolyte stimulates a skin. The electrolyte skin contact causes a sore and stimulation on the skin.
Eye contact: The steam of the electrolyte stimulates eyes. The electrolyte eye contact causes a sore and stimulation on the eye.
Especially, substance that causes a strong inflammation of the eyes is contained.
